Ticket VYN-2214: Inventory reconciliation job double-counts transfers

The Stockhaven reconciliation job counts warehouse-to-warehouse transfers in both the source and destination ledgers when the transfer spans a midnight boundary. Proposed fix: key deduplication on transfer ID plus effective date rather than ingestion timestamp. Reviewer, please check the boundary tests in `recon_transfer_test` carefully — the prior fix regressed silently. Reproduced on the staging snapshot whose build token appears below.

pipeline stamp: htk9_ce63042d9

### Handling Clock Skew Across Gantry Build Agents

Short version for plugin authors: Gantry build agents drift, sometimes by a few seconds, so never compare raw timestamps across agents to order events. Use the coordinator's logical sequence instead, and treat wall-clock deltas under the skew tolerance as "simultaneous." Your plugin gets these bounds from the SDK, but for sanity-checking, the current tolerances are as follows.

constants for bawif-kawif:
QUOTAS = {
    "ulaael": 5,
    "holael": 10,
}

Ticket #4471 — Signature check failing on health endpoint

Since yesterday's rollout, the Bramwick load balancer marks backend nodes unhealthy because the /status payload fails signature verification. The health checker validates signed responses, and nodes provisioned this week shipped with a stale verification bundle. As the new contractor, you'll need to redeploy the trust config to all four nodes in the Velden pool. For verification, the checker expects the key below.

signing key of bagap-yawep = bky13_TbfT6ZMUoGJo2